Garrowhill to Addiewell by train

A train trip from Garrowhill to Addiewell takes about 2hrs 3 mins on average, covering roughly 20 miles (32 kilometres). With around 37 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£16.50,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Garrowhill to Addiewell are available for £17.70 one way, or £31.40 return

Station Facilities & Ticketing

For those planning their travels, Garrowhill train station's ticket office operates from Monday to Saturday, opening bright and early at 05:56 and closing at 19:44. Though there's no staffed ticket service on Sundays, the station is well equipped with self-service ticket machines where you can easily collect tickets booked online. These machines are accessible to those with mobility impairments, ensuring that purchasing tickets is straightforward for everyone.

In terms of support, there's a help point where passengers can rely on staff assistance during the hours that the ticket office is open. With customer information screens displaying departures and announcements, you'll be kept in the loop about your journey plans. While the station does feature an induction loop to assist hearing-impaired passengers, it lacks accessibility features like lifts or wheelchair availability, indicating its Category B rating due to the need for passengers to navigate using ramps and stairs.

Accessibility and Convenience

While offering step-free access on certain platforms, passengers should be mindful of the possible prominence in the gap between train and platform when boarding or alighting. There are no toilet facilities or baby-changing areas, so travelers should plan accordingly. Secure bicycle storage is limited but available, supporting the eco-conscious commuter. Station Facilities and Amenities

Addiewell station is a simple, yet functional railway station. It does not host a ticket office or any ticket machines, meaning travelers need to plan ahead to purchase tickets online before their journey. However, there are measures in place for those needing assistance. An induction loop is available for those with hearing difficulties, and there's step-free access throughout the station. Information is never far as departure screens and announcements keep passengers updated on their journeys. For any lost items, ScotRail's lost property service is available, and further queries can be directed to customer relations.

Accessibility and Transport Options

The station categorically falls under accessibility category A, which ensures step-free access to both platforms, though caution is advised when boarding or alighting at the rear of platform 1. As there's no parking designated for those with disabilities, it might be necessary to make alternate arrangements. Bus services connect easily by accessing the stop on Livingston Street, enhancing city and local travel connections. Although there isn't a permanent taxi rank, taxi services are available through TrainTaxi, ensuring you're never stranded.
